Year 5 Camp – Bathurst Gold Fields
Last week Year 5 set off to the Blue mountains and then Bathurst for some out of classroom learning about early explorers and the life on the goldfields.
First stop was Featherdale Wildlife Park and a close up encounter with a variety of Australian animals, including a Shingle Back Lizard and feeding the friendly Pademelons. We then drove up into the Blue Mountains where students experienced the Scenic Railway and cable car over the Jamison Valley. After arriving at our accommodation in Bathurst, students listened to stories from a local bushman around the campfire and then bushed danced the night away under the stars.
The following day students toured the replica goldfields, a fully functioning mine and blacksmith shop as well as prospecting for gold, with some striking it rich. Thank you to all the teachers for this wonderful and enriching experience.

Japanese Sports Afternoon – Taiiku no hi
Primary students have been learning about the tradition of Sports Day in Japan. Sports Day (スポーツの日), is a national holiday in Japan held annually. It commemorates the opening of the 1964 Summer Olympics held in Tokyo, and exists to promote sports and an active lifestyle. On Wednesday 25 November, students will compete in a variety of sporting activities that encourage team work. All students will rotate through activities with their class members on the oval. Activities will include three legged race, big ball roll, skipping, tug-o-war, water relay, sprints ... just to name a few. It will be an afternoon of fun and games.
Students are to wear their sport uniform and can also wear House tshirts.
